Golgi apparatus This organelle modifies molecules and packages them into small membrane bound sacs called vesicles. These sacs can be targetted at various locations in the cell and even to its exterior. Lysosome This organelle digests waste materials and ...

Eukaryotic Cell Definitions: = Typically Found Only In Plant Cells = Typically Found In Animal Cells Golgi Apparatus: A series (stack) of flattened, membrane-bound sacs (saccules) involved in the storage, modification and secretion of proteins (glycoproteins) and lipids destined to leave the cell ( ...

Homogalacturonan (HG) is a pectic polysaccharide, consisting of a chain of a-1,4 linked galacturonic acid residues. HGs are synthesized in the Golgi-apparatus as methyl esters and transported inside vesicles to the cell surface. Wall-bound pectin methyl esterases (PME) ...
